Breakthrough algorithm from MUSC reduces hospitalization for the youngest sickle cell patients
The Pediatric Emergency Medicine and Pediatric Hematology/Oncology divisions at the Medical University of South Carolina teamed up to create and test an algorithm for treating children with sickle cell disease who arrived at the ED with a fever.
The algorithm helps providers better determine which kids should be admitted and who should go home for treatment with close follow-up from the hospital.
